include <stdio.h> void primeNum(int x){ int i;for(i=2;i<=x;i++){ if(x%i==0){break;}} if (x==i)printf("%d is a prime number",x);else printf("%d is not a prime number",x);} main(){ int a;scanf("%d",&a);primeNum(a);getchar();} ...
(1)编写一个素数判断的函数prime,判定给定的素数是否是素数,如果是则返回1,否则返回0。 prime(int x) {int k,i; k=sqrt(x); for(i=2;i<=k;i++) if(x%i==0) break; if(i<=k) return 0; else return 1; } (2)应用prime函数来统计101~200之间有多少个素数。